How to calculate the liquefied natural gas, japan to natural gas, us ratio
Liquefied Natural Gas, Japan to Natural Gas, US ratio = Liquefied Natural Gas, Japan price per Million British Thermal Units ÷ Natural Gas, US price per Million British Thermal Units
Both legs share the same unit, so the result is a plain unitless number, directly comparable across time.
Worked example, live prices: $15.77 ÷ $2.79 = 5.652. The inverse is 0.1769.
